Output 50c8a26ef38f05ba99fb710bb9203d84f5b160ef1d1ad7e8d2437d6c5eb6001a:0

value
38373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ed59c8ed40d000fb1073918da3e6bf85cdfebc1 OP_EQUAL
address
35xeuMmm1uDJRXzbsacXVZNqsrs62g4En2
transaction
50c8a26ef38f05ba99fb710bb9203d84f5b160ef1d1ad7e8d2437d6c5eb6001a
confirmations
341156
spent
true